Job Description

Meta is seeking an Energy Manager for its Clean Energy Contracts team in Honolulu, HI. The role involves managing renewable energy contracts, ensuring compliance, monitoring project performance, and resolving contract issues. Candidates should have a relevant degree and at least 5 years of experience in renewable energy contract management. The position offers a salary range of $126,000 to $179,000 per year, along with bonuses and benefits.
Summary:

In this role, you will be a key contributor to Meta's Global Energy Team, specifically the Clean Energy Asset Management Team. You will be responsible for managing a portfolio of clean and renewable energy contracts and as needed, carbon reduction or carbon removal agreements, including: supporting/leading negotiations for amendments, ensuring contract compliance, monitoring project development and construction status, and reporting on financial and operational performance for operating projects. You will have the opportunity to master contract details, analyze financial and operational project performance, resolve disputes, and propose solutions.

Energy Manager (Clean Energy Contracts) Responsibilities:

1. Serve as the ongoing owner for all of Meta's executed clean energy and carbon contract requirements

2. Create, maintain, update documents and data related to clean and renewable energy contracts

3. Track counterparty compliance with contract milestones and other deliverables

4. Respond to counterparty inquires and manage contract amendments, collateral, force majeure claims, and other issues as needed

5. Surface and resolve issues in ongoing contracts and project operations

6. Track and analyze clean energy operational project performance

7. Track and analyze renewable energy financial project performance

8. Track project progress through development and construction milestones and lead risk reporting against schedule and forecast

9. Manage approval and signature process for contract documents after execution

10. Support invoicing and reporting on clean energy contracts, and ensure that RECs, costs and project performance are consistent with contract terms and conditions

11. Coordinate with legal counsel, finance, accounting, purchasing, accounts payable/receivable and other key stakeholders
• *Minimum Qualifications:**

Minimum Qualifications:

12. Bachelor's degree in business, energy or environmental science, paralegal studies or similar

13. 5+ years of work experience with an corporate renewable energy buyer, IPP, owner operator, electric utility, energy supplier, or energy intensive industrial or consumer company

14. Experience managing a portfolio of renewable energy contracts, especially wind and solar energy supply contracts

15. Experience drafting official correspondence between counterparties and experience developing and maintaining partnerships with suppliers and internal stakeholders

16. Experience with G-Suite, Excel, Word, and Tableau

17. Experience in building cross-functional relationships

18. Experience analyzing and interpreting energy generation data, virtual PPAs, green tariffs, and wholesale energy market data
